Daniel Craig is the best Bond to me, and Timothy Dalton and George Lazenby are underrated Bonds. Dalton's portrayal was ahead of his time and Craig's style took some inspiration from him I think. If you haven't seen The Living Daylights and Licence to Kill, do so. The Living Daylights has one of the best fights in the Bond series imo, and John Barry's score for the film is great too.

License to Kill is severely underrated. Its a grittier, more violent, slightly more down to Earth Bond with one of the best villains in Robert Davi. A bad motherfucker if there ever was one.
